非常小的成本实现一个图床(远远不止)

2020-03-02 08:06:14 +08:00
 int64ago

可以直接先体验 https://302.at/

手机也可以扫码体验(用浏览器打开):

下面就啰嗦下介绍下

应该很多人都跟我一样有图床的需求,我几年前其实就做了,实现也很简单,就是找个对象存储服务商(比如七牛、阿里云 OSS 等)通过 SDK 实现,但是一直很别扭。周末重新梳理了下,我个人对此类需求有以下诉求:

然后,周末我就把上面的需求都实现了,并且还扩展了很多其它实用的功能

特性

技术栈及依赖

一些预览图

有兴趣的话代码在 GitHub,可以 fork 过去自己改改就能部署,绝大多数配置我都抽离成环境变量了,当然直接用也可以,不过最好登录下,非登录态会有些限制

5168 次点击
所在节点    分享创造
56 条回复
miao666
2020-03-02 11:04:26 +08:00
楼主,图床的精髓是白嫖其他大厂的资源啊,你用到自己的 OSS 就已经输了。
哪天你的帖子火了,流量费用好几百你不肉疼吗😂
int64ago
2020-03-02 11:08:36 +08:00
@miao666 不要慌,我都有考虑

资源是小事,免费资源多得很,主要是易用度很重要,再说不觉得我这个很快么 🤓

最后,放心,火不起来的 😄
d5
2020-03-02 11:12:00 +08:00
很酷,star 一下!

另外,图床的精髓是白嫖其他大厂的资源啊,这个还是十分有道理 hhh
cmdOptionKana
2020-03-02 11:15:33 +08:00
刚刚上传了个视频,上传速度奇快无比!
cmdOptionKana
2020-03-02 11:16:51 +08:00
@int64ago 鉴黄服务贵不贵?
xinxing260
2020-03-02 11:17:52 +08:00
可以都放自己的 nas 上
int64ago
2020-03-02 11:19:44 +08:00
@cmdOptionKana 还好,基本可以忽略
xinxing260
2020-03-02 11:21:35 +08:00
@d5 你说的很对,图床的精髓是白嫖
ostrichb
2020-03-02 11:25:49 +08:00
@int64ago 刚刚看到有敏感资源,建议筛查一下
qk1683518
2020-03-02 11:52:36 +08:00
我日 打开一看都是黄图
Ev1s
2020-03-02 11:56:24 +08:00
刚看了一下 你这没有内容筛查的吗,怎么什么奇奇怪怪的东西都有 -_-||
qiguai2017
2020-03-02 11:57:16 +08:00
第一眼看到黄图了
6IbA2bj5ip3tK49j
2020-03-02 11:59:22 +08:00
这个鉴黄意思就是把非黄色图片全部过滤掉吗?
NeinChn
2020-03-02 11:59:27 +08:00
看了楼上几楼,突然觉得现在图床最大的开销在机器学习判断图片是否合规上
xxx027
2020-03-02 12:33:25 +08:00
网站打不开:-(
ERR_CONNECTION_REFUSED
duoduo1x
2020-03-02 12:35:14 +08:00
无法访问此网站 302.at 拒绝了我们的连接请求。
int64ago
2020-03-02 12:50:10 +08:00
@ostrichb
@qk1683518
@Ev1s
@qiguai2017
@xgfan
@NeinChn
@xxx027
@duoduo1x

刚刚停服清理违规内容,并且上了新规则,必须登录才能上传
ShundL
2020-03-02 12:56:34 +08:00
一直好奇想你这么个服务的 oss 每月开销多少。。。
int64ago
2020-03-02 13:05:49 +08:00
@ShundL 看情况,目前块把钱
HereApp
2020-03-02 14:10:38 +08:00
Mac 上可以做成 Here 插件试试
t/643399

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://tanronggui.xyz/t/648993

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X